In need of a little getaway We thought you might be! Nestled just steps from Blanco State Park, this updated 1920's farmhouse offers a peaceful retreat for all. The river views, visible from the front porch or the treehouse perched in an ancient oak, ensure this! Spend your time tasting vino at vineyards or exploring the outdoors like Pedernales Falls State Park. Contrast your on-the-go days with relaxing nights around the 2-bed, 1-bath vacation rental's fire pit.

BLANCO TO DO’S: Old Blanco County Courthouse (0.5 miles), Redbud Cafe (0.6 miles), Cranberry’s Antiques (0.6 miles), Blanco River Pizza Company (0.6 miles), Old 300 BBQ (0.7 miles), Deutsch Apple Bakery (1.2 miles), Buggy Barn Museum (1.5 miles), Real Ale Brewing Company (1.9 miles)
VINEYARDS: Esperanza Winery (0.4 miles), Narrow Path Winery & Vineyard (13.6 miles), Pontita Vineyard & Winery (14.4 miles), Texas Hills Vineyard (15.1 miles), William Chris Vineyards (17.9 miles), Duchman Family Winery (36.5 miles)
OUTDOOR DESTINATIONS: Blanco State Park (800 feet), Jacob’s Creek Park (22.7 miles), Jacob’s Well Natural Area (23.9 miles), Pedernales Falls State Park (26.3 miles), Guadalupe River State Park (31.5 miles)
DAY TRIPS: Fredericksburg (33.3 miles), Austin (50.0 miles), San Antonio (50.2 miles)
AIRPORTS: San Antonio International Airport (41.6 miles), Austin-Bergstrom International Airport (54.0 miles)
